  NHTSA Recall 80V010000

NHTSA Campaign Id 80V010000; Date: Feb. 15, 1980

icon1 Recalled Vehicles:

1980 Dodge Challenger 1980 Dodge Colt 1980 Plymouth Champ 1980 Plymouth Sapporo

Component: Interior Lighting

Manufactured by: Chrysler Corporation

Affected Units:: 25,004

icon3 Recall Summary:

The ashtray bulb socket in the involved vehicles may have been manufactured with materials that do not possess the required electrical resistance qualities. When the ashtray bulb is lit for an extended period of time, the socket is subject to overheating.

icon2 How to Fix:

The dealer will remove the existing bulb socket and wiring assembly and replace it with components that have the proper electrical resistance qualities, at no charge to owner.

icon4 Recall Notes:

Vehicle description: passenger vehicles. System: lighting and communications; ashtray bulb socket. Consequences of defect: an overheated socket can cause an instrument panelfire, possibly resulting in personal injury to vehicle occupants. Note: until the vehicle is serviced, the owner is advised to remove the ashtraylamp connector.

Date Owners notified by Manufacturer: Apr 3, 1980
